CTC Tea Remains the Dominant Format in India's Production Mix
Source: Tea Board India · Published: 2026-07-01
Executive Brief
India's production data continue to show the dominant role of CTC tea, reflecting demand for fast colour, strong liquor and efficient tea-bag performance.

What Happened
CTC manufacturing creates small, uniform particles that release colour and strength quickly. Its dominance in India reflects both domestic drinking habits and international demand for economical tea bags and strong blends.
Why It Matters to Tea Buyers
For manufacturers, the relevant cost is not only the invoice price per kilogram. A tea that performs efficiently can reduce the quantity required per bag or per pot and provide more stable consumer results.
West Africa Buyer Impact
West African distributors exploring black tea can use CTC as a separate product line while keeping traditional Chinese green tea as the core of local social tea preparation.
The practical value of this development depends on the buyer's target market, product category and distribution model. A mass-market Chunmee product, a black tea bag and a premium specialty tea require different decisions even when they are influenced by the same global event.
